Question
If
sec
x
-
tan
x
=
2
3
,
then tan x = ___________.
Open in App
Solution
Given
sec
x
-
tan
x
=
2
3
1
Since
sec
2
x
-
tan
2
x
=
1
⇒
sec
x
-
tan
x
sec
x
+
tan
x
=
1
⇒
2
3
sec
x
+
tan
x
=
1
⇒
sec
x
+
tan
x
=
3
2
2
Subtracting (1) from (2)
sec
x
+
tan
x
-
sec
x
+
tan
x
=
3
2
-
2
3
⇒
2
tan
x
=
9
-
4
6
⇒
2
tan
x
=
5
6
⇒
tan
x
=
5
12
